SF Giants’ Luis Gonzalez and Joey Bart hit back-to-back home runs in win over Cubs
SAN FRANCISCO — The pop off Joey Bart’s bat rang loud. But the roar of the crowd was a little louder.
Once Bart’s seventh home run landed 411 feet into the left field stands, broadcast cameras panned to Will Clark, team president Larry Baer and everyone else sitting nearby pointing at him as he grinned. Just hours earlier at his No. 22 jersey retirement ceremony, Giants luminaries praised Clark for bringing a special spark to the team nearly 40 years ago that this team could desperately use.
They channeled Clark a bit on Saturday with an explosive three-run inning. They’d even collected two runs a few innings earlier on back-to-back RBI hits from Austin Slater, who doubled Darin Ruf home from first base, and Yermin Mercedes, who singled Slater home.
